It hasn't to date. The polygon orientation options look especially useful. However, it only supports 4 point locations though (MapServer does 9) and doesn't support curved label placement. On the surface there's a lot of overlap between PAL and the stock label placement code. Would be interesting to see the same map labeled by both for visual and speed comparisons.
I think any effort in this area would need to be spearheaded by a particularly interested user, organization and/or developer. If there were significant improvements demonstrated over the existing engine then that would help things. Steve >>> On 11/18/2009 at 2:55 PM, in message <[email protected]>, "G.
